氮磷钾配施对田周地种植桂牧1号杂交象草产量及效益的影响

摘    要:通过不同的施肥处理方案研究在田周地种植桂牧1号杂交象草Pennisetum purpureum cv.Guimu 1的氮、磷、钾需要量及其最佳配比模式。结果表明,在田周地种植桂牧1号杂交象草,通过合理的氮、磷、钾配方施肥,能够达到良好的生产效果与效益。实测结果以N2P2K2(氮肥414 kg/hm2,磷肥138 kg/hm2,钾肥276 kg/hm2)试验组的产量最高(256.81±1.18)t/hm2],与其他低水平试验组差异均达到极显著水平(P<0.01);与无肥处理相比,增产率达到16.6%。通过对各处理进行效应模型的配置与分析,得出田周地种植桂牧1号杂交象草的预测最高产量为259 t/hm2,对应施肥量为氮肥414621 kg/hm2、磷肥140 kg/hm2、钾肥204 kg/hm2;预测最佳经济产量为256 t/hm2,对应施肥量为氮肥414 kg/hm2、磷肥140 kg/hm2、钾肥172 kg/hm2。

Effects of N,P,K and their combinations on yield and benefit of hybrid Pennisetum purpureum cv. Guimu No.1 grown in field bund

Abstract:The demands and optimum proportion of N, P and K of hybrid Pennisetum purpureum cv. Guimu No.1 grown in field bund were studied with "3414" design. The results showed that its response to formula fertilizing was good. Among the treatments, the best one is N_2 P_2 K_2 (N 414 kg/hm~2, P_2O_5 138 kg/hm~2, K_2O 276 kg/hm~2) and its yield was the highest (256.81±1.18) t/hm~2], and the difference with the low level treatments was significant (P<0.01). The yield was increased by 16.6% compared with the check. Based on the analysis of the effect prediction model, the estimated highest yield was 259 t/hm~2 and the relevant fertilizing formula was 414 to N 621 kg/hm~2, P_2O_5 140 kg/hm~2 and K_2O 204 kg/hm~2. The best economic formula wasN 414 kg/hm~2, P_2O_5 140 kg/hm~2 and K_2O 172 kg/hm~2, and the relevant yield was 256 t/hm~2.
